24-1120

Discuss and consider approval of a resolution of the City of New Braunfels, Texas, authorizing the use of eminent domain proceedings for the acquisition of permanent easements and temporary construction easements that are necessary to advance and achieve the public use of expanding the New Braunfels Utilities’ wastewater system, (the “McKenzie Interceptor Upgrade Project”), to increase sewer capacity to meet existing and future needs and ensure reliability, in the event negotiations are unsuccessful: a. Properties owned by N.B. Avery Park Homeowners Association, Inc: i. a 0.296 Acre Permanent Utility Easement, a 0.044 Acre Temporary Construction Easement, and a 0.213 Acre Temporary Construction Easement (Guadalupe County Parcel No. 125092); ii. a 0.632 Acre Permanent Utility Easement, a 0.312 Acre Temporary Construction Easement, and a 0.022 Acre Temporary Construction Easement (Guadalupe County Parcel Nos. 171818 and 171819); b. Properties owned by Rockspring Saur LLC: i. a 2.088 Acre Permanent Utility Easement and a 1.395 Acre Temporary Construction Easement (Guadalupe County Parcel Nos. 191564 and 108128); c. Properties owned by GCP III St. Croix Landco, LLC: i. a 1.937 Acre Permanent Utility Easement and a 1.127 Acre Temporary Construction Easement (Comal County Parcel Nos. 421640; 422735; and 441204); and d. Property owned by MP New Braunfels, LLC: i. a 1.846 Acre Permanent Utility Easement and a 0.847 Acre Temporary Construction Easement (Comal County Parcel No. 71650),
